A dental implant is a titanium screw surgically placed inside the jawbone which functions as an artificial tooth. The process is called osseointegration, the implant gradually fuses to the bone tissue. After healing is complete, a custom crown is secured to the implant so that you walk away with something that looks, feels and functions as close to a natural tooth as possible. Establishing a secure foundation makes for much more stability than removable dentures or traditional bridges.
What you might not know is one of the best things about dental implants is how well they help keep your jawbone healthy. Bones shrink in size when teeth are lost due to a lack of stimulation. Dental implants can prevent this loss of bone, however, acting as artificial roots for teeth and assisting your jaw to support the structure of your face. In addition to oral health, this functionality also helps avoid the sunken appearance often associated with missing teeth.

Dental implants also are one of the longest lasting options available. Although crowns need to be replaced at some point after many years of normal wear, the implant itself can last a lifetime with good oral hygiene and regular dental visits. Avoiding common mistakes like brushing twice a day, flossing carefully around the implant site and routine professional cleanings are key to the success of your implant.
Not everyone gets dental implants right after losing a tooth however, many people are prime candidates for the treatment. Treatment requires healthy gums, sufficient jawbone density and good overall health. For those who have lost bone, supplementation (grafting) may also be required to improve the jaw before inserting an implant. A full exam, complete with digital imaging, ultimately gives us the information we need in determining each patient's best treatment options.
In most cases, the treatment involves multiple stages that require enough time to heal between treatments. This can require patience, but the benefits are often far more valuable than the immediate inconvenience.
